If you’ve read Heat of the Moment, then you’re already familiar with Carson Scott. He’s a SEAL, a wild and sexual guy but the only different between him in this book and the guy from the last book is that Carson doesn’t want to be the one-night-stand guy anymore. He wants commitment and he wants a relationship.

Unfortunately for him, Holly Lawson, the girl he had a hot quickie with in the supply closet of a club, doesn’t want to date him. She just wants a fling. As Holly proposes an affair, Carson is trying to get a hold of his feelings for Holly.

In an explosive mix of chemistry, sexual tension and a heady dose of dirty talk, HEAT OF PASSION  ignites with a fiery passion. Kennedy doesn’t wait long to turn the heat up. In fact, she jumps right in, whether you’re ready or not.

Though too short to really create a concrete romance between the two, this short story is a hot quickie, perfect for a little pick-me-up if you need something a little more spicy in your reading material.

About Elle Kennedy

A RITA-award nominated author, Elle Kennedy grew up in the suburbs of Toronto, Ontario, and holds a B.A. in English from York University. From an early age, she knew she wanted to be a writer, and actively began pursuing that dream when she was a teenager.

Elle currently publishes with Harlequin Romantic Suspense, Harlequin Blaze, Samhain Publishing, and NAL. She loves strong heroines and sexy alpha heroes, and just enough heat and danger to keep things interesting!
